Understanding Psychiatry Psychiatry is a branch of medication focused on diagnosing, treating, and preventing mental health disorders. Psychiatrists are medical doctors who focus on the mental health field, which distinguishes them from psychologists. They can recommend medications, conduct treatment, and deal various treatments tailored to private needs.
Why You Might Need a Psychiatrist Before diving into how to find one, it's important to acknowledge the indications that may indicate the requirement for psychiatric assistance. Here are some essential indicators:
Signs You May Need a Psychiatrist Description Persistent Sadness Continuous sensations of sadness or despondence for more than 2 weeks. Anxiety or Irritability Continuous worrying, uneasyness, or irritation affecting daily life. Modifications in Appetite/Sleep Significant weight loss/gain, or sleep disturbances like insomnia or hypersomnia. Withdrawal from Activities Disliking social, work, and leisure activities. Substance Abuse Increasing reliance on drugs or alcohol to deal with emotions. Ideas of Self-Harm or Suicide Experiencing thoughts about self-harm or suicide needs instant aid. Kinds Of Psychiatric Care Not all psychiatric conditions are the exact same, and different experts may appropriate depending on the condition. Here are some specializeds within psychiatry:
Specialty Description General Psychiatry Concentrate on identifying and dealing with a broad series of mental conditions. Kid and Adolescent Psychiatry Concentrates on mental health concerns in children and teenagers. Geriatric Psychiatry Handle the elderly, resolving specific age-related mental health problems. Drug Abuse Psychiatry Concentrate on diagnosing and treating substance-related conditions. Forensic Psychiatry Works at the intersection of mental health and the legal system. How to Find a Psychiatrist Near You Finding a psychiatrist doesn't have to be a complicated job. Here are some practical steps to assist you find the right one closest to you:
1. Usage Online Tools Psychology Today: This platform provides a directory site of therapists, including psychiatrists, that you can filter by location, insurance, and specialty. Healthgrades: A website that lists doctor, consisting of psychiatrists, with client evaluations and rankings. Zocdoc: You can browse for doctors based on your insurance coverage and schedule visits online. 2. Consult Your Primary Care Doctor Your primary care doctor can offer recommendations based on your general health and particular mental health needs.
3. Contact Your Insurance Provider Consult your insurance provider for a list of covered psychiatrists in your area to ensure your sees are cost effective.
4. Connect to Mental Health Organizations Organizations like the National Alliance on Mental Illness (NAMI) can offer resources and lists of specialists.
5. Ask for Referrals from Friends and Family Though it can feel delicate, trusted buddies or family members might be able to recommend a psychiatrist they've had a positive experience with.

What to Expect During Your First Visit The very first appointment with a psychiatrist can feel frustrating. Nevertheless, understanding what to expect can assist alleviate anxiety.
Initial Assessment: The psychiatrist will carry out an extensive assessment, including your case history, symptoms, and psychiatric history. Be truthful-- this info is vital for your treatment.
Diagnosis: After collecting adequate info, they will supply a diagnosis based on the criteria established in the DSM-5 (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ders).
Treatment Plan: Depending on the diagnosis, they will discuss proper treatment alternatives, which might include therapy, medication, lifestyle modifications, or a combination.
Follow-Up: You will likely schedule follow-ups, permitting the psychiatrist to monitor your progress and make modifications as required.
